Chief of Staff Gen. David Goldfein announced the assignment of Brig. Gen. Patrick Doherty as commander of 19th Air Force at JBSA-Randolph, Texas. Doherty currently serves as commander of the 82nd Training Wing at Sheppard AFB, Texas. He will replace Maj. Gen. James Hecker, who has led the numbered Air Force, which is responsible for training some 30,000 US and allied students each year, since June 2015.
